Re: Bakhram Murtazaliev vs. Tim Tszyu | PRIME PBC - October 19, 2024
Demolition job from Murtazaliev, didn't see that coming although I knew nothing of him going in, pretty evenly matched 1st round, both were landing but round 2 Tszyu got dropped hard by a left hook then a quality right/left, he fought pretty well after second knockdown but got rocked again amd and down from rights, last shot looked back of head but no intent, Tszyu was still in a bad way coming out for 3rd, as soon as he went down in the 3rd it should've been stopped, again it was that left hook, top drawer from Murtazaliev, thankfully not long after the towel come in, ref was horrendous
